Branches Pruning in Reno, NV
Branches pruning services involve selectively trimming and removing specific branches of trees and shrubs to improve their health, appearance, and safety. This type of project often includes thinning overgrown limbs, removing dead or damaged branches, and shaping trees to promote better growth and airflow. Homeowners typically request this service to prevent potential hazards from falling branches, enhance the aesthetic appeal of their landscape, or maintain the structural integrity of mature trees.
Before requesting branches pruning, property owners should consider the current condition of their trees and shrubs, including identifying any dead or diseased limbs. It is also helpful to understand the desired outcome, whether that is a more open canopy, improved safety, or a specific aesthetic style. Knowing the scope of the project and any specific concerns about the health or safety of the trees can ensure the pruning work meets expectations and supports the ongoing vitality of the landscape.

Common Branches Pruning Jobs
Tree pruning - selective removal of branches to improve tree health and structure.
Thinning - reducing dense foliage to increase sunlight and airflow through the canopy.
Dead branch removal - taking out broken or diseased branches to prevent decay and damage.
Structural pruning - shaping trees to promote strong growth and reduce risk of falling limbs.
Crown cleaning - removing crossing or rubbing branches to prevent wounds and decay.
Overgrown branch trimming - reducing excessive growth to maintain a balanced and attractive appearance.
